Position Summary We are seeking a motivated Junior Electrical Engineer to join our growing team. This entrylevel role supports the design testing troubleshooting and commissioning of highquality electrical panels and relative systems. The ideal candidate is an earlycareer professional with a strong foundation in electrical engineering principles and a willingness to learn in a handson environment. You will work alongside experienced engineers and technicians to develop skills in variable frequency drives (VFDs) PLC and HMI programming AutoCAD drafting and electrical system testing. Responsibilities include but are not limited to: - Assist in the design and development of electrical systems for control panels and shore power cables.
- Create and update electrical schematics and panel layouts using AutoCAD or similar software.
- Support testing and troubleshooting of electrical components and systems in production and field environments.
- Participate in the configuration and commissioning of VFDs and PLC/HMI systems.
- Collaborate with production and field service teams to ensure quality and performance of built systems.
- Assist with documentation including test procedures wiring diagrams and user manuals.
- Support field startup troubleshooting and commissioning efforts under supervision.
- Stay current on industry standards tools and technologies in electrical engineering.
- Maintain safe work practices and compliance with relevant codes and standards (UL NEC NFPA).
- Participate in ongoing training and mentorship provided by senior engineering staff.
